Keeping your kitchen tidy, hygienic, and practical can make cooking easier and more enjoyable. Here are 30 essential kitchen tips that every home cook should know:
Wash dishes and clean surfaces while cooking to avoid clutter and mess.
Use sharp knives for safer and more efficient cutting.
Store spices in a cool, dry place to maintain freshness.
Label leftovers with dates to track freshness easily.
Use separate cutting boards for meat and vegetables to ensure food safety.
Keep a trash bowl on the counter while cooking to reduce trips to the trash.
Use airtight containers for pantry items to keep them fresh longer.
Measure ingredients before cooking to make recipes easier to follow.
Separate fruits and veggies to reduce waste.
Clean naturally with vinegar or baking soda to keep your kitchen eco-friendly.
Practice FIFO – First In, First Out to avoid expired products.
Keep frequently used tools within reach to save time while cooking.
Set timers while cooking to prevent overcooking.
Store knives safely to prevent accidents.
Clean cutting boards with lemon and salt to remove stains and odors.
Preserve herbs by freezing to extend their shelf life.
Organize your fridge by zones to make food easier to find.
Use silicone baking mats to save time washing trays.
Keep a small towel handy for instant cleaning.
Quick garlic peeling tip: shake cloves in a container to make cooking faster.
Keep root vegetables separate to extend storage life.
Clean boards with lemon juice for fresh smell and disinfecting.
Use a sharp peeler for vegetables to get smooth results.
Label freezer bags with content and date to avoid confusion.
Keep a dedicated utensil holder to prevent clutter.
Prevent oil splatter with a lid or guard to keep the stove clean.
Keep bread fresh in a box to prevent molding.
Use leftover vegetable water as stock to reduce waste and add flavor.
Maintain knife edges to cook efficiently.
Organize spices for easy access to cook with convenience.
